Haryana Chief Minister Nayab Singh Saini on Monday, June 1, 2026, extended warm congratulations to Nagendra Nath Tripathi on being entrusted with the significant responsibility of Rashtriya Sangathak (Varishtha Karyakarta Sampark) — National Organiser (Senior Worker Outreach) — within the Bharatiya Janata Party.

Context

Saini took to X to convey his felicitations, writing: 'Aadaraniya Shri Nagendra Nath Tripathi ji ko Rashtriya Sangathak (Varishtha Karyakarta Sampark) ka mahatvapurna dayitva milne par hardik badhai evam shubhkamnayen' — 'Heartfelt congratulations and best wishes to respected Shri Nagendra Nath Tripathi ji on receiving the important responsibility of National Organiser (Senior Worker Outreach).' He added that Tripathi's experience would lend fresh momentum to organisational coordination and worker outreach.

The post, made in Hindi, reflects the Chief Minister's role as a senior BJP leader who regularly acknowledges party appointments at the national level.

Policy Backdrop

The BJP maintains a sharp structural distinction between its government wing and its organisational apparatus. National-level roles such as Sangathak (Organiser) are part of the party's internal hierarchy, designed to bridge state units with central leadership and ensure grassroots worker engagement remains robust.

Such appointments are a recurring feature of BJP's organisational calendar, particularly following state elections or leadership transitions, when the party undertakes systematic reviews to refresh coordination mechanisms. Haryana itself has seen multiple organisational reviews since the party first formed a government in the state in 2014.

Stakeholders and Impact

The role of Rashtriya Sangathak (Varishtha Karyakarta Sampark) is specifically oriented toward senior party workers — the experienced cadre that forms the backbone of BJP's election machinery and on-ground mobilisation. Effective outreach to this segment is considered critical for sustaining party cohesion between election cycles.

For Haryana BJP, acknowledgement of such appointments by the Chief Minister signals the state unit's alignment with national organisational priorities, reinforcing the link between Chandigarh and the party's central leadership in New Delhi.
